director’s statement



The pressure of ambition,
success, and especially 
competition is an issue that 
haunts many youths. Trying to 
figure out where they’re meant 
to be and go, always comparing
to peers and feeling like, or even
being told to their face that 
they’re not at their highest 
potential.


I firmly believe that success and ambition is not the most important thing in life. Sometimes ‘failure’ can lead to redemption and internal happiness/validation, and there is no such thing as ‘wasting time’ in finding your place in life. Hopefully that can relate to the younger generation and even my peers, and allow them to appreciate themselves and life around them more.
